WebSep 22, 2024 · An interrogation is a formal process where an interrogator systematically questions a person with the goal of eliciting a voluntary confession or admission of guilt. In general, the person being interrogated is either the suspect or some other person thought to be complicit in the offense. By nature, an interrogation is more direct and accusatory. Army Deputy Chief of Staff for Intelligence Lieutenant General John Kimmons displays the manual on June 6, 2006. [1] [2] Army Field Manual 2 22.3, or FM 2-22.3, Human Intelligence Collector Operations, was issued by the Department of the Army on September 6, 2006.
